r/RobotVacuumsBest robot that does NOT have a dock
8 days ago

The roborock Q8 max is on sale right now for a good deal, it has no multifunction dock and just the basic charge station. Also has basic obstacle avoidance though not camera based. Good vacuuming performance in general. Has a sizeable bin capacity too. And a big benefit over other non-self emptying models, the dust container is at the back and the charge points are at the front. So you can pull out the bin without having to pull the whole robot off the dock. Second choice would be the Q10 S5, though the bin is smaller and cant be accessed unless you pull the entire robot off the dock and turn it around. Though it claims higher suction than the Q8 I wouldn't put much weight on suction claims. The Q8 vacuums quite well too. If you are mainly vacuuming hard floors, the narwal freo x plus could also be a good choice. Large bin capacity and good anti tangle system on the roller, but I found carpet vacuuming performance is lacking. I believe it's on sale now too. Unfortunately a lot of the no-dock models now share the design with self emptying units, which means often the bin is harder to access because it was designed with self empty in mind.

r/RobotVacuumsRoborock Q8 just dropped 15%; is this my time to get my first robot vac?
8 days ago

I think for your needs and expectations it's a good choice. It'll vacuum hard floors well and the bin is decently sized so you might not even need to empty it each use depending. And it'll have the software features you need to keep it away from the rug. I would say the mop is where it falls down, it's a very basic system and IMO not worth bothering with. But you can just not attach the mop and not put water in the tank. It's easy to specify vacuum only in the app. Just wanted to make sure you didn't have 5 dogs and expected it to vacuum a house full of deep pile carpet without needing to be emptied is all! It's a good deal for what it is I think. And I prefer the Q8 to their other low price machines like the Q7 L5 etc.
